摘要
油田热采中所用蒸汽的干度无法直接测量,但它的精确测量直接关系油田产量和经济效益。本文在均相流模型的基础上,考虑滑速比对干度的影响,并利用文丘里管的两相流测量原理,建立蒸汽干度的预测模型。经实验验证,该模型可以预测流经文丘里管的蒸汽干度,误差在8%以内,满足工程上的精度要求。
Steam quality used in oilfield thermal recovery cannot be directly measured,but its accurate measurement is directly related to oilfield production and economic benefits.In this paper,on the basis of the homogeneous flow model,considering the influence of the slip ratio on steam quality,and making use of two phase flow measurement principle of Venturi tube,the forecast model of the steam quality was established.Experimental results show that the model can predict the steam quality by Venturi tube,and the error is less than 8%,which can meet the engineering accuracy requirements.
